PHOTOS: A playful start for Crawford North Coast

For some it was the beginning of a new chapter of their academic lives.

A comical replay of popular fairytales kicked off the opening of Crawford College North Coast with the executive head, Vernon David, and his staff putting on a show to help the new Grade 8’s ease into their first day.
